Diti is an acronym for ‘Do it to it’.
This was a popular thread revived by Ronnie (Adobe_One_Kenobi) during 2014.
Basically we all have a turn to submit a photograph for the week.
Anybody is then welcome to manipulate, add to or clean up in whatever way they feel inspired to do.
